2026 年小程序引入 CDN JS 的最佳实践是优先采用微信官方小程序云开发 CDN 或国内头部云厂商(如阿里云、酷番云)的 HTTPS 加速节点,严禁直接引用非 HTTPS 资源,否则将导致页面加载失败或安全拦截。

随着 2026 年微信生态安全策略的进一步收紧,小程序对静态资源加载的合规性要求已达到毫秒级精准控制,在小程序引入 cdn js的实操中,开发者必须摒弃旧时代的“直接外链”思维,转向“云托管 + 智能分发”架构,这不仅关乎加载速度,更直接决定了小程序在百度搜索结果中的收录权重与用户留存率。

核心架构:2026 年 CDN 引入的合规路径与性能基准
安全协议与平台红线
2026 年,工信部与各大平台联合发布的《移动互联网应用服务安全规范》明确规定,所有小程序静态资源必须强制使用 HTTPS 协议,且证书需由受信任的 CA 机构签发。
- 强制 HTTPS:任何 HTTP 协议的 JS 文件引用均会被微信客户端直接拦截,导致 `loadScript` 失败。
- 域名白名单:引入的 CDN 域名必须预先配置在小程序后台的“业务域名”列表中,否则无法调用。
- 资源完整性:必须开启 SRI(Subresource Integrity)校验,防止 CDN 节点被劫持导致代码篡改。
主流 CDN 方案对比分析
针对**小程序引入 cdn js 价格**与性能平衡,以下是 2026 年行业头部方案对比数据:
| 方案类型 | 代表厂商 | 接入延迟 (ms) | 成本模型 | 适用场景 |
| :— | :— | :— | :— :— |
| 云开发原生 | 微信云托管 | 15-30ms | 按量付费,含在云函数额度内 | 轻量级插件、内部工具库 |
| 公有云 CDN | 阿里云/酷番云 | 20-45ms | 流量包 + 请求数计费 | 大型 SaaS 系统、高并发场景 |
| 第三方聚合 | 七牛云/又拍云 | 30-60ms | 阶梯定价,含免费额度 | 初创团队、中小型企业 |
| 自建节点 | 私有化部署 | 60-120ms | 高运维成本,需自建 TLS | 金融、政务等强数据隔离需求 |

实战数据:头部案例的加载优化
据 2026 年 Q1 百度移动生态技术报告,某头部电商小程序在将核心 JS 库从本地打包迁移至 CDN 后,首屏渲染时间(FCP)从 1.8 秒下降至 0.6 秒,这一数据验证了**小程序引入 cdn js 对比**本地打包的优势:资源压缩率提升 40%,带宽成本降低 65%。
实施策略:从配置到优化的全流程指南
域名配置与 HTTPS 证书管理
在**小程序引入 cdn js**之前,必须完成以下基础建设:
- 域名备案:确保 CDN 域名已完成 ICP 备案,且备案主体与小程序主体一致。
- 证书部署:在 CDN 控制台配置 SSL 证书,强制开启 HSTS(HTTP Strict Transport Security)。
- 后台配置:在微信公众平台后台“开发”->“开发设置”中,将 CDN 域名添加至“业务域名”列表。
代码加载逻辑与容错机制
2026 年的开发规范要求代码必须具备极强的容错性,建议使用异步加载策略,避免阻塞主线程。
- 动态加载:使用 `wx.request` 获取 JS 内容后通过 `eval` 执行,或直接使用 `